Developer Sunk $10.5M Into Contaminated Land, NC Suit Says

By Hayley Fowler ( August 4, 2026, 6:16 PM EDT) -- An environmental consulting company allegedly failed to warn a real estate developer that property in North Carolina was contaminated with dry-cleaning chemicals until after the developer sunk $10.5 million into trying to develop the land, according to a state Business Court lawsuit....
